Mad Horse Creek Wildlife Management Area
A perfect place for boating. Saltwater fish, waterfowl, pheasant and rabbits inhabit this 9,345-acre area of tidal marsh and upland habitat. Concrete boat ramp and parking at site. Area is located on Stow Neck Rd. Take Rt. 623

Borough of Woodstown
Quaint, yet thriving, downtown district with homes dating from the 18th and 19th century. Home to the Woodstown Friends Meeting House (1785) and the Samuel Dickeson House (c.1749-1785)
